PRODUCT INFO
There are many different varieties of Cucumbers that can be divided into two different groups: pickling and slicing. Pickling cucumbers are smaller, can be oblong and short to long and cylindrical, and have thin, green skin which is ideal for pickling. Slicing cucumbers are large and cylindrical, averaging 15-20 centimeters in length, and have thick skin. The skin can be smooth or ribbed with small bumps and nodes depending on the variety. Slicing cucumbers are most commonly seen in the local market's produce section and can range in color from dark green, to yellow or white. The inner flesh is light green with pale, edible seeds and has a crisp, aqueous texture and mild floral and grassy flavor.

USES
Cucumbers are commonly consumed raw. Slice cucumbers and add to salads or a crudite plate. Marinate Cucumbers in oil, vinegar, and spices and serve with sugar snap peas and mint leaves. Shred Cucumber into a cheesecloth and squeeze to remove as much moisture as possible and then mix with yogurt and dill for a tatziki sauce. It can also be sliced lengthwise, diced, and added to quinoa or bulgur wheat salad. Cucumbers pair well with mint, dill, tuna fish, chicken salad, tomatoes, green peppers, and onions. Cucumbers will keep for a few days when stored in the refrigerator. If only a portion of the Cucumber is used, wrap the remaining piece tightly in plastic and store in the refrigerator to prevent dehydration.

SEASONS
Cucumbers are available year-round.

Cucumbers are a refreshing, hydrating vegetable with a crisp texture and mild taste, making them a popular choice for salads, sandwiches, and cooling beverages. Composed of about 95% water, cucumbers are excellent for hydration and low in calories, making them ideal for weight management.

They are rich in antioxidants, vitamin K, and several important phytonutrients that support skin health and reduce inflammation. Cucumbers can be eaten raw, pickled, or blended into juices and smoothies for a refreshing treat. Their light, crisp flavor pairs well with a wide range of dishes, offering a fresh crunch.
